Output 88323f95ddf0a26cd2b6b6a10ea81526fb9a648180ca549e1790e5a53b2b45b0:0

value
11772826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b3441afce5f833de4e4d03379f23712c5190c93 OP_EQUALVERIFY OP_CHECKSIG
address
14wSf6ovBd6ofcVxs8BdqS6tYoufuJn5xA
transaction
88323f95ddf0a26cd2b6b6a10ea81526fb9a648180ca549e1790e5a53b2b45b0
spent
true